Online Store and POS Software: Why It Matters for Small Retailers
In 2025, small retail businesses face stronger competition, smarter customers, and faster buying decisions than ever before. Traditional cash billing and standalone systems are no longer enough to survive in a digital-first market. This is where an online store integrated with POS software becomes essential for small retailers.
An online store and POS system working together helps retailers manage sales, inventory, customers, and payments from one platform—saving time, reducing errors, and increasing revenue.
1. Sell Anytime, Anywhere
Today’s customers don’t shop only during store hours. They browse products online, place orders from home, and expect quick fulfillment. An online store allows small retailers to sell 24/7, while POS software ensures all sales—online or offline—are recorded in one system.
This integration helps retailers capture more sales without increasing staff or overhead costs.
2. Real-Time Inventory Management
One of the biggest challenges for small retailers is stock management. Without real-time inventory updates, businesses face stock-outs, overstocking, or expired products.
When your POS software is connected to your online store, inventory updates automatically after every sale. This ensures accurate stock levels across all channels and helps retailers make smarter purchasing decisions.
3. Faster and Error-Free Billing
Manual billing leads to pricing mistakes, incorrect GST calculations, and longer checkout times. POS software speeds up billing using barcodes, product search, and automated tax calculation.
Fast billing improves customer experience and reduces queues—an important factor for repeat business.
4. Better GST Compliance and Reporting
GST compliance is a major concern for small retailers. A POS system generates GST-compliant invoices, applies correct tax rates, and prepares ready-to-use reports for filing.
This reduces dependency on manual calculations and minimizes the risk of penalties.
5. Build Strong Customer Relationships
An integrated POS and online store captures valuable customer data such as phone numbers, purchase history, and preferences. Retailers can use this data to:
- Run loyalty programs
- Offer discounts and coupons
- Send promotional messages
Customer data helps small retailers increase repeat sales and build long-term relationships.
6. Data-Driven Business Decisions
POS software provides detailed reports on daily sales, best-selling products, profit margins, and inventory movement. These insights help retailers understand what works and what doesn’t.
In 2025, smart decisions backed by data give small retailers a competitive edge..
7. Easy Scalability and Business Growth
As the business grows, managing multiple products, staff, or even locations becomes difficult with manual systems. POS software with an online store scales easily and supports growth without operational chaos.
Conclusion
For small retailers, an online store combined with POS software is no longer a luxury—it’s a necessity. It enables faster sales, better inventory control, GST compliance, and improved customer engagement.
